What is LMQL?
LMQL은 자연스러운 언어 프롬프트와 Python의 표현력을 결합하여 대규모 언어 모델(LLM)을 위해 특별히 설계된 쿼리 언어입니다. 제약 조건, 디버깅, 검색, 제어 흐름과 같은 기능을 제공하여 LLM과의 상호 작용을 용이하게 합니다.
주요 특징:
제약 조건: 지정된 기준을 충족하도록 생성된 출력에 대한 조건을 지정합니다.
디버깅: LLM이 출력을 생성하는 방식을 분석하고 이해하여 미세 조정 및 오류 식별에 도움을 줍니다.
검색: 일반적인 작업을 위한 미리 작성된 프롬프트에 액세스하여 편리한 시작점을 제공합니다.
제어 흐름: Python 제어 흐름 문을 사용하여 생성 프로세스를 보다 세밀하게 제어합니다.
자동 토큰 생성 및 유효성 검사: 필요한 토큰을 자동으로 생성하고 제공된 제약 조건에 따라 생성된 시퀀스의 유효성을 검사합니다.
임의의 Python 코드 지원: Python 코드를 사용하여 동적 프롬프트와 텍스트 처리를 포함합니다.
More information on LMQL
Top 5 Countries
72.28%
15.73%
7.01%
3.22%
1.76%
United States
India
Germany
Canada
Spain
Traffic Sources
8.35%
1.01%
0.06%
10.95%
34.99%
44.61%
social
paidReferrals
mail
referrals
search
direct
Source: Similarweb (Sep 24, 2025)
Related Searches





